Full Recipe:
For the Salad:
3 cups cooked pasta (penne, rotini, or your choice)
2 cups cooked chicken, diced or shredded
3 cups romaine lettuce, chopped
1/2 cup cherry tomatoes, halved (optional)
1/3 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1/4 cup croutons (optional)
For the Dressing:
1/2 cup mayonnaise
1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
2 tbsp lemon juice
1 tsp Dijon mustard
1 garlic clove, minced
Salt and pepper, to taste
2–3 tbsp water, to thin (if needed)
Cook Pasta: Cook pasta according to package instructions. Drain and rinse under cold water to cool. Set aside.
Prepare D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together mayonnaise, Parmesan,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, minced garlic, salt, and pepper. Add water a little at a time to reach desired consistency.
Assemble Salad: In a large bowl, combine cooled pasta, cooked chicken, chopped romaine, cherry tomatoes, and Parmesan cheese.
Add Dressing: Pour the dressing over the salad and toss until everything is evenly coated.
Serve: Sprinkle croutons on top just before serving for extra crunch. Serve chilled or at room temperature.
